What is the deadline for submitting my personal tax return using this organizer?
Typically, personal tax returns in Canada are due by April 30 for individual taxpayers. If you are self-employed, your return is generally due by June 15, with any taxes owed by April 30.

How does processing times work when using this organizer?
Processing times for tax returns can vary based on how you submit your form. E-filed returns are typically processed faster than mailed ones, usually within a few weeks. However, during peak tax season, processing times may be longer.
